Mosto × Nextdoor: A Fire-Fuelled Feast Lands in Berawa for One Night Only

Some nights are made for the calendar. Others, for the group chat. This one is both.

On Thursday 27 November, Bali’s cult-favourite neo-bistro Mosto is teaming up with Nextdoor, the South Perth kitchen known for its flame-kissed cuts and no-rules approach to meat, for a one-night-only chef collab that promises to go big, go bold, and go late.

They’re calling it: one night, all fire, no rules.

This is not a tasting menu. There’s no gentle progression. No palate cleanser. Just two chefs - Mosto’s Lorenzo De Petris and Nextdoor’s Elliot “Chef Macbeth” Sawiris, throwing down on the grill with an à la carte line-up built around prime Australian cuts, smoke, and serious flavour.

Expect plates that hit hard and linger long: OP rib, Southern Australian lamb, snacks that punch above their weight, and wine by the glass to match. Loud plates, turned-up textures, and nothing playing it safe.

So, who’s behind it?

If you’ve been eating your way through Bali lately, you’ve probably sat at Mosto’s concrete bar. Opened by the team behind  Bar Bacetto and Luma, it’s one of the island’s few natural wine bars with a menu that walks the line between bistro and banger - anchovy toast, fresh pasta, and buttery proteins are the norm.

Chef Lorenzo De Petris, with previous stints at Le Gavroche (London) and The Waterside Inn, brings sharpness to every plate, but lets it breathe in the Bali heat.

Enter Chef Macbeth, aka Elliot Sawiris. The Nextdoor head chef is a cult name in Perth’s food circles: known for unapologetic cooking, open flames, and some of the best meat-led menus in WA. His kitchen at Nextdoor runs next to family-owned butchery and produce shop “Our Table”, which means one thing: he knows his cuts.

This is a chef who treats proteins like poetry, but still knows when to turn up the heat.
